Where can scholarship recipients attend Law Preview?  

Scholarship recipients can attend the BARBRI 1L Law Preview course on-demand from the comfort of their own home.  

Who oversees the scholarship application/acceptance process? 

We provide the proper links and forms to facilitate online scholarship applications. Scholarship sponsors review applications, make their selections, and communicate their decisions to the applicants. Law Preview then registers accepted applicants into the course.

Why should I take Law Preview?

Law Preview builds better law students. If you are planning to enter law school, the grades you earn during the 1L year will largely determine whether you will see a meaningful return on the investment you’re making in a legal education. 

Law Preview is a carefully designed program that positions serious students to excel during the all-important 1L year by providing overviews of the core first-year subjects as well as proven study and exam-taking tactics. 

Mathematically, a law student’s first semester grades will largely determine their overall first-year GPA and class rank. Given the cost of a legal education, walking into your 1L without a proven plan for finishing at the top of your class is a profoundly flawed strategy. 

How do I know if Law Preview is right for me? 

Whether you are entering a T14 law school on a full-ride or just got in off the waitlist at a lower-ranked school, you applied to law school to provide yourself with more options upon graduation. 

While almost all students in your class will make the same investment of time and money for a law degree, first-year students in the top 10% simply have more options than their classmates in the bottom 90%. This is because top 1L grades open doors while even average grades close them. 

Walking into law school with a solid game plan yields more options upon graduation. 

Are there prerequisites for enrollment? 

There are no prerequisites to attend Law Preview. Most of our students take our program after they have been admitted to law school, during the summer before they begin classes. 

However, a growing number of students are taking Law Preview even before they apply to law school to better understand the subject matter and workload before making such an important decision.

How long will I have access to the on-demand course? 

The on-demand course will be available to registered students until May 31, 2026.

Is there homework? 

Yes. Just like law school, you’ll have pre-assigned readings to complete before beginning each lecture. You can download the syllabus here

Do I really need to brief all my cases? 

Yes, we will review the case briefing process and provide a template for you to use. 

Are there reading assignments during the course? 

Yes, there are several reading assignments from the digital course book we recommend you complete in conjunction with several of the lectures. 

I am visually or hearing impaired. Will Law Preview make reasonable accommodations? 

For students who are visually impaired, we will provide written materials in a digital format that works with screen reader software. For students who are hearing impaired, all lectures have closed captioning available.
